Why the clean install? I though Apple doesn't install crapware like other manufacturers.

BTW, this will be my first Mac ever, so any tips/suggestions for a new system, please post. :)

There's a big long thread on this very subject buried somewhere on the forum. :) I decided to reinstall as it removes all the extra languages and certain 'trial' products. It buys you some space on the hard drive, and I personally have no need for the languages or trials. You might be able to just drag the trial apps to the trash, but I'm not sure it's as 'clean' as just reinstalling.
